Dionysiades
Dionysiades is a poet and writer.
Also recorded as Dionysiades of Tarsus.
Overview
Born at Mallus.
In detail
the recorded working language is Ancient Greek.
Subjects and genres recorded for the work are tragedy.
Membership is recorded of Alexandrian Pleiad.
